[analyzer] PthreadLockChecker: model failed pthread_mutex_destroy() calls.
pthread_mutex_destroy() may fail, returning a non-zero error number, and keeping the mutex untouched. The mutex can be used on the execution branch that follows such failure, so the analyzer shouldn't warn on using a mutex that was previously destroyed, when in fact the destroy call has failed.
